Stapenhill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Stapenhill Come From? nationality or country of origin
Stapenhill is found in England more than any other country or territory. It may appear in the variant forms:. For other possible spellings of this surname click here.
How Common Is The Last Name Stapenhill? popularity and diffusion
This surname is the 2,718,172nd most frequently occurring last name internationally It is held by approximately 1 in 142,893,057 people. Stapenhill occurs predominantly in Europe, where 75 percent of Stapenhill are found; 75 percent are found in Northern Europe and 75 percent are found in British Isles.
It is most widespread in England, where it is held by 38 people, or 1 in 1,466,265. In England it is primarily found in: Dorset, where 37 percent live, West Midlands, where 29 percent live and Staffordshire, where 13 percent live. Not including England this surname is found in one country. It is also common in The United States, where 25 percent live.
Stapenhill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Stapenhill has changed through the years. In England the number of people carrying the Stapenhill surname expanded 152 percent between 1881 and 2014.
